About 10pm, Bridgewater Police responded to the incident and Crime Scene Examiners and Crash Investigators attended.
The 19-year-old driver, and the other two occupants of the vehicle, were not injured and remained at the scene.
An investigation into the circumstances surrounding the death has commenced and a report is being prepared for the coroner.
Police are asking people to come forward with information about the fatality, particularly if anyone witnessed a woman walking along the Brooker Highway between Claremont and the Midland Highway from 8pm-10pm.
The woman was wearing a black top, blue jeans, black sneakers and had a black suitcase with her.
"Police would also like to talk to anyone who may have given the woman a lift in their vehicle during this time," Senior Sergeant Jason Klug said.
